Freeze-thaw and seasonal moisture can cause settling, frost heaving, and surface breakdown if materials are not chosen or installed properly. Well-draining aggregates and proper compaction, base preparation, and edge restraints reduce movement and extend lifespan. Regular maintenance after winter, like regrading and topping up material, helps maintain performance.

Well-graded, permeable aggregates and layered installations with geotextile fabric often provide the best drainage and help reduce erosion on slopes. Combining terraces, retaining features, and proper slope grading with the right materials helps manage runoff. For steep or sensitive sites, consult a contractor or our team to match the material and installation technique to the slope and soil conditions.

Maintenance needs and costs vary by material, usage, and exposure; low-traffic decorative areas may only need topping up every few years, while driveways and high-traffic paths require more frequent regrading or compaction. Typical upkeep includes occasional raking, weed control, and adding material as it settles. For a realistic budget, get a contractor estimate based on your specific material and use pattern.

The material will be delivered via dump truck. If your order is under 20 tons, then it will likely be just one dump truck load. If your order is more than 20 tons, it will be more than one dump truck load.
Absolutely! Try our aggregate quiz here: https://hellograve3dev.wpengine.com/aggregate-quiz/ Alternatively,you can call us, chat with us (box in the bottom right corner of the website), or email us!
We cannot get out of the truck and manually spread it. However, depending on the location, safety, and comfortability of the driver – we may be able to tailgate spread your material. This involves pulling the truck forward as material is being dumped to make it easier for you to distribute material after delivery.
